Weak entry list for Pau F3
The Pau International F3 street race has had a disappointing entry in its inaugural year
Just 23 cars are on the entry list for the French race in 11 days' time.
All the frontrunners from the French and Italian championships have entered, but a clashing round of the German series and the attendance of only one British team leave the field short of quality.
The solo British squad, Carlin Motorsport, will run its pair of Dallara-Mugens for Narain Karthikeyan and Michael Bentwood.
'The entry's not as good as we'd like to see it, said race organiser Barry Bland, 'but the Italian teams have seen the importance of the event and they've decided to go.'
Bland added that German teams have pledged 15 cars for the race in 2000, as long as there is no clashing championship race.
He believes that British teams will compete if the Germans do. 'The UK teams said that, if the German teams weren't going this year, there was no point in entering,' he said.
